Pemex taps ICA Fluor to build $1.3B delayed coker at Miguel Hidalgo refinery
This Phase II contract involves providing detailed engineering, procurement and construction (EPC) services for the 86,000-bpd capacity plant at Pemex's refinery in Tula, Mexico.
Toyo wins EPC work for new Sasol PE plant in US
The new LLDPE unit will be part of Sasol’s petrochemical complex under development in Lake Charles, Louisiana. Toyo has been executing the FEED services for this plant since 2013.

BioAmber to supply bio-succinic acid in lubricants
Under the terms of the five-year contract, BioAmber Sarnia, a joint venture with Mitsui & Co., will supply Oleon with bio-based succinic acid for the development of succinate lubricants.

Replan: Modernizing Brazil’s largest crude oil refinery
The project included installing two hydrodesulfurization (HDS) units for the cracked naphtha produced by two catalytic cracking units, a coker naphtha hydrotreating (HDT) unit, and a catalytic reforming unit.
